Archibald (Archie) Cecil Norrie
October 30, 1927 — August, 3, 2010
Archibald (Archie) Cecil Norrie died Tuesday, Aug. 3, 2010,
at the Reston Health Centre at the age of 82, following a long
illness with congestive heart failure. Archie was the beloved
husband of Jean and loving father to Joanne, Janice and Denise.
Born on a farm near Decker, MB, on Oct. 30, 1927, Archie
was the seventh child in a family of 10 born to John and
Helen Norrie. In 1942, the family moved to a farm near
Isabella, MB, where Archie, at age 14, took over the
management with the help of his younger brothers, Cyril and Gordon.
Their father's suffering from the after-effects of World War I was
the reason for his prolonged absences from the farm, as he would
often need to stay in the Deer Lodge Hospital in Winnipeg because
of his ill health.
In 1947, Archie worked as a farmhand around Midnapore, AB. In 1950,
he returned to Manitoba and worked on the Alexander farm near Decker
and on a farm near Isabella for Jack Finkbeiner and his son, Johnny.
On Nov. 14, 1953, Archie married Jean Harrison of Isabella and
together they raised three daughters. His love of farming lead to the
purchase of the farm homesteaded by Jean's maternal grandparents,
Charles and Jane Craig, where he lived with Jean until 2005 when
they moved to Virden, MB.
